SLB closes ChampionX deal after navigating complex merger remedies

By Flavia Fortes ( July 16, 2025, 21:46 GMT | Comment) -- SLB, formerly known as Schlumberger, announced today it has completed its acquisition of rival oilfield service supplier ChampionX, 15 months after entering into the $7.8 billion transaction. The deal’s clearance was shaped by a patchwork of jurisdiction-specific remedies, reflecting the complexity of global merger enforcement.
